Larbert station makes your travel experience straightforward and hassle-free with its vital facilities. The ticket office is open from 07:00 to 20:54 every day of the week except Sunday, ensuring you have ample time to handle your ticketing needs. Ticket machines are readily available, and they are equipped with induction loops for the hearing impaired, making ticket services both friendly and accessible. While modern conveniences like smartcard issuing are not available, there are smartcard validators for easy travel.
Larbert is more than just a pitstop — it's a hub brimming with onward travel options. Visitors can conveniently access local and regional bus services, with detailed schedules available at Traveline Scotland. For those seeking personalized travel options, taxi services can be arranged through Train Taxi. If you're in need of a ride, rest assured knowing the station’s car park facilitates easy drop-off and pick-up without any parking fees.
Welcome to a space that endeavors to provide access to all. The station features step-free access on some parts and ramps for train access to help those with mobility impairments. Although there are no accessible toilets and dedicated accessible taxis, Passenger Assist services can be arranged for those requiring additional help, ensuring every traveler feels accommodated.

Bare Lane may initially seem modest with no ticket office or staffed help, yet it is equipped with essential amenities that cater to key travel needs. Travelers can obtain their tickets effortlessly from the available ticket machines, which also support online ticket collection and are designed to be accessible for all users. In addition, step-free access is provided to ensure ease of movement throughout the station, making it manageable for individuals with mobility issues.
While the station itself lacks modern conveniences like Wi-Fi, an ATM, or dining facilities, it still offers some basic comforts like seating areas and shelters for cycle storage. Safety measures have not been overlooked, as CCTV surveillance covers the premises, providing assurance to passengers.
For those concerned about getting to their final destination from Bare Lane, there's reassurance in its transport connectivity. Local bus services operate efficiently, with routes heading to Lancaster and Morecambe from nearby bus stops. If you prefer a more private journey, taxi services are available for direct access to desired locales. Comprehensive travel information can be planned in advance, thanks to printable journey guides.
